How to play
Plot a route to a concealed checkpoint by entering a compass bearing and a distance for each leg. The contour map shows the terrain; spend your stamina wisely as you travel toward the goal.
- Set a bearing and distance, then travel that leg of the course
- Use contour lines to read slopes and pick efficient ground
- A limited stamina budget means wasted legs cost you
- Reveal-next-leg hints are available if you're stuck

Tips & strategy
- Aim slightly toward the checkpoint each leg rather than guessing the whole route at once
- Follow gentler contours — climbing and detours drain stamina
- Bank the reveal hint for a leg where a single nudge confirms the direction
